Turning off your system

Every time you turn off your system, shut down the operating system first.
You may lose data if you do not follow the proper procedure.

When you turn the computer off by pressing the power
button, some electric current still flows through the
computer. Before opening the computer case or
connecting or removing any peripherals, turn off the
computer and then unplug the power cord and modem
cord (if installed).
You can use the power button to turn off your system if
the system does not respond to commands. However, you
must hold the power button in for 4 seconds to turn it off
(Windows 95 and Windows 98 only).
